SATA International Donate Material to Orphanages/needy institutions in Cameroon.

When Capt. Otílio Machado and his volunteers began their Solidarity Action for Douala in September 2009; the generous and kind people of Lisbon, Portugal gave them their support by contributing clothes, shoes, toys, educative materials, food, household items etc. With the help of one of CAPEC past volunteer, who has volunteered in one of the orphanages, the crew were able to identify CAPEC which is supporting a good number of orphanages in Douala and Yaoundé with International volunteers in providing social needs for orphan children. The donation shall be distributed to orphanages in Douala, Yaoundé, and Kumba. Other institutions that shall benefit from the donations are Handicap Centres, Schools for the Deaf, Centres for the blind, and most importantly children in the rural villages, whose parents cannot afford to buy them clothes. During their visit to Cameroon, the SATA Crew was able to visit some of the orphanages which shall benefit from the donation.
